Each month, on the first Wednesday, scholars and experts from within and beyond the RFF community will speak on important energy, environmental, and natural resource topics, with plenty of time left over to exchange ideas.

 

The seminar series runs during the academic year, from September through December, and from February through June. Events are held at the RFF Conference Center, first floor, 1616 P Street NW, Washington, DC, from 12:30-2 p.m. A casual lunch will be available at 12:30 p.m. and seminars begin promptly at 12:45 p.m.
